Position OverviewWe are currently working a 12-hour, rotating shift schedule (typically Monday-Friday), with a block of 6 consecutive days off every 3-week cycle. Maintenance employees may be required to work Saturdays.ResponsibilitiesThis position is responsible for performing preventive and unscheduled maintenance on the building, grounds, and machinery at the Green Bay Coated Products Division. We are currently seeking candidates with industrial maintenance experience. Duties may include but are not limited to: An understanding of PLC's (Rockwell & Siemens), AC and DC drives, instrumentation, maintenance/upgrading of building electrical system This position will also be responsible for general mechanical maintenance duties.QualificationsRequired: Associate Degree or Certificate in Electro/Mechanical Technology or EngineeringConsidered: 5+ years of industrial maintenance experience, willingness to continue education to obtain a certification/degree.Compensation & BenefitsIn addition to a competitive wage, the selected candidate will enjoy a comprehensive benefit package including medical, dental, vision, prescription drug, wellness programs and an on-site medical clinic free for employees and their families, STD, LTD, life insurance, company matching 401(k) and pension.Company OverviewStarted in 1933, Green Bay Packaging Inc. is a family owned, vertically integrated company consisting of corrugated container plants, a folding carton facility, recycled and virgin containerboard mills, pressure-sensitive label roll stock plants, timberlands, a paper slitting operation, and a sawmill facility. Headquartered in Green Bay, Wis., Green Bay Packaging Inc. employs over 4,600 team members and operates 40 facilities in 16 states, each with a dedication to innovative development of its products and forestry resources, with a focus on safety, sustainability, quality, and continuous improvement.
